十进制和二进制的转化;原码、反码和补码
来源:互联网 发布:雅思自测软件 编辑:程序博客网 时间:2024/05/19 18:38
因为数在计算机中是以二进制的形式表示的,并且在其最高位是其符号位,如六位整数000001=1,而100001=-1;
原码:原码就是这个数的二进制形式;正数的补码和反码和原码相同,而负数的反码为原码除了符号位之外其他位求反,如100001的反码即为111110,负数的补码为其反码在末位加1,如100001的补码为100010。
十进制和二进制的转化:
1)数学公式中
例:17的二进制为17不断除以2,,然后保留余数,并将余数从后往前写出即为17的二进制形式,10001;
二进制10001转化为十进制为10001=1*(2^4)+0*(2^3)+0*(2^2)+0*(2^1)+1*(2^0)=17
0 0
- 十进制和二进制的转化;原码、反码和补码
- 原码, 补码, 和反码的区别与转化;
- 原码、反码和补码的实现
- 原码,反码和补码的关系
- 计算机的原码、反码和补码
- 负数的原码反码和补码
- 计算机的原码, 反码和补码
- 计算机的原码, 反码和补码
- 计算机的原码, 反码和补码.
- 计算机的原码, 反码和补码
- 原码、反码和补码
- 原码、补码和反码
- 原码、补码和反码
- 原码、反码和补码
- 原码、反码和补码
- 原码、反码和补码
- 原码、反码和补码
- 原码、反码和补码
- SQL 左连接 右连接 内连接
- Mips内核调试遇到Unhandled kernel unaligned access[#1]:以及BadVA : dead4ead
- Ubuntu Linux解决:修改profile文件无法进入Ubuntu的方法
- 第一天
- React实战-深入源码了解Redux用法之Connect
- 十进制和二进制的转化;原码、反码和补码
- Android RecyclerView自定义点击事件和长按事件
- table does not exists,select 1 from tablename limit 1
- POJ 2417 Discrete Logging (BSGS)
- Codewars 9月刷题
- mvc架构理解
- Windows API Index
- Chrome控制台实用指南
- 二维数组中的查找